Is Canva still free? This is a question that many users have been asking lately. Canva is a popular graphic design tool that allows users to create stunning visuals for various purposes such as social media posts, presentations, posters, and more. It offers a wide range of features and templates that make it easy for anyone to design professional-looking graphics. When Canva first launched, it had a free plan that provided access to basic features and a limited selection of templates. However, over the years, Canva has introduced new subscription plans and premium elements that may make you wonder if it is still possible to use Canva for free. The good news is that Canva still offers a free plan! While there are additional paid options available, you can still use Canva without spending a dime. The free plan provides access to thousands of templates, millions of stock photos and illustrations, and basic design tools. One of the standout features of Canva's free plan is its user-friendly interface. Whether you are a beginner or an experienced designer, you will find it easy to navigate through the platform. The drag-and-drop functionality allows you to effortlessly add elements to your designs and customize them according to your needs. In addition to the user-friendly interface, Canva's free plan also includes numerous customization options. You can change colors, fonts, sizes, and even add your own images or logos to make your designs truly unique. With these options at your disposal, the possibilities for creativity are endless! Canva's free plan does have some limitations, though. While you have access to a vast library of templates and stock photos, some premium elements may not be available without upgrading to a paid plan. Similarly, certain advanced features like background removal or resizing designs without losing quality may require a subscription. If you find yourself needing more advanced features or access to premium elements, Canva offers several subscription options. The Canva Pro plan provides additional features such as resizing designs, transparent backgrounds, and the ability to create a brand kit with customized colors and fonts. There is also an option for teams called Canva for Enterprise. To summarize, Canva is still free and continues to be a valuable tool for individuals and businesses alike. The free plan offers a wide range of features and templates that allow you to create stunning graphics without spending any money. However, if you require advanced features or premium elements, upgrading to a paid plan may be necessary.
